diff -u --new-file --recursive --exclude-from /usr/src/exclude v2.2.17/arch/s390/tools/hwc_cntl_key/hwc_cntl_key.c linux/arch/s390/tools/hwc_cntl_key/hwc_cntl_key.c
@@ -1,69 +0,0 @@
-/*
- * small application to set string that will be used as CNTL-C
- * employing a HWC terminal ioctl command
- *
- * returns: number of written or read characters
- *
- * Copyright (C) 2000 IBM Corporation
- * Author(s): Martin Peschke <peschke@fh-brandenburg.de>
- */
-
-#include <string.h>
-#include <stdio.h>
-
-/* everything about the HWC terminal driver ioctl-commands */
-#include "../../../../drivers/s390/char/hwc_tty.h"
-
-/* standard input, should be our HWC tty */
-#define DESCRIPTOR 0
-
-int main(int argc, char *argv[], char *env[])
-{
- unsigned char buf[HWC_TTY_MAX_CNTL_SIZE];
-
- if (argc >= 2) {
- if (strcmp(argv[1], "c") == 0 ||
- strcmp(argv[1], "C") == 0 ||
- strcmp(argv[1], "INTR_CHAR") == 0) {
- if (argc == 2) {
- ioctl(DESCRIPTOR, TIOCHWCTTYGINTRC, buf);
- printf("%s\n", buf);
- return strlen(buf);
- } else return ioctl(DESCRIPTOR, TIOCHWCTTYSINTRC, argv[2]);
-// currently not yet implemented in HWC terminal driver
-#if 0
- } else if (strcmp(argv[1], "d") == 0 ||
- strcmp(argv[1], "D") == 0 ||
- strcmp(argv[1], "EOF_CHAR") == 0) {
- if (argc == 2) {
- ioctl(DESCRIPTOR, TIOCHWCTTYGEOFC, buf);
- printf("%s\n", buf);
- return strlen(buf);
- } else return ioctl(DESCRIPTOR, TIOCHWCTTYSEOFC, argv[2]);
- } else if (strcmp(argv[1], "z") == 0 ||
- strcmp(argv[1], "Z") == 0 ||
- strcmp(argv[1], "SUSP_CHAR") == 0) {
- if (argc == 2) {
- ioctl(DESCRIPTOR, TIOCHWCTTYGSUSPC, buf);
- printf("%s\n", buf);
- return strlen(buf);
- } else return ioctl(DESCRIPTOR, TIOCHWCTTYSSUSPC, argv[2]);
- } else if (strcmp(argv[1], "n") == 0 ||
- strcmp(argv[1], "N") == 0 ||
- strcmp(argv[1], "NEW_LINE") == 0) {
- if (argc == 2) {
- ioctl(DESCRIPTOR, TIOCHWCTTYGNL, buf);
- printf("%s\n", buf);
- return strlen(buf);
- } else return ioctl(DESCRIPTOR, TIOCHWCTTYSNL, argv[2]);
-#endif
- }
- }
-
- printf("usage: hwc_cntl_key <control-key> [<new string>]\n");
- printf(" <control-key> ::= \"c\" | \"C\" | \"INTR_CHAR\" |\n");
- printf(" \"d\" | \"D\" | \"EOF_CHAR\" |\n");
- printf(" \"z\" | \"Z\" | \"SUSP_CHAR\" |\n");
- printf(" \"n\" | \"N\" | \"NEW_LINE\"\n");
- return -1;
-}
